DETROIT, MI –– A red-hot Mariners offense handed Tarik Skubal a loss at Comerica Park on Friday, July 11. The Seattle Mariners defeated the Detroit Tigers, 12-3. Detroit entered the game boasting a league best 59-35 record. The homestand against the Mariners also serves as the 25th anniversary celebration of Comerica Park.
